Role Summary

This role is part of the Data Management Enablement (DME) Center of Excellence and supports enterprise data governance through Collibra Data Quality Catalog (metadata) and Data Lineage capabilities. The associate acts as a hands-on enablement expert helping data stakeholders design effective data quality rules onboard and manage metadata and maintain lineage. This is a COE support role focused on tooling support stakeholder engagement and driving adoption of governance practices.

Key Responsibilities

  • Design support and optimize data quality rules in Collibra Data Quality (CDQ)

  • Perform data profiling validation and root cause analysis to improve data quality

  • Support metadata ingestion catalog curation and business glossary management in Collibra

  • Assist in documenting and maintaining end-to-end data lineage

  • Design configure and manage Collibra workflows (issue remediation approvals data certification CDE lifecycle)

  • Optimize workflows to improve efficiency traceability and auditability

  • Provide day-to-day platform support (workflows permissions inbox issue resolution)

  • Translate business requirements into DQ rules metadata structures and configurations

  • Run office hours trainings and user support sessions to drive adoption

  • Support UAT release validation and production readiness

  • Contribute to reporting audit and compliance (e.g. BCBS 239 (data risk aggregation regulation) GDPR)

  • Identify opportunities to improve automation efficiency and governance processes including AI-driven enhancements

  • Support AI-assisted metadata discovery classification and tagging and stay current with emerging governance AI capabilities
